One of the key services offered by cell culture companies is the development and maintenance of cell lines. Cell lines are populations of cells that are cultured and propagated in a controlled environment to study their behavior, characteristics, and responses to different stimuli. These cell lines are essential for a wide range of applications, including drug discovery, disease modeling, toxicity testing, and regenerative medicine. cell culture companies work closely with researchers to provide a diverse selection of well-characterized cell lines that can be used for various experimental purposes. These companies also offer custom cell line development services, allowing researchers to create cell lines that are tailored to their specific research needs.
In addition to cell lines, cell culture companies also produce a variety of cell culture media and reagents that are essential for maintaining cell viability and functionality in vitro. Cell culture media are specially formulated solutions that provide cells with the necessary nutrients, growth factors, and supplements to support their growth and proliferation. These media are developed to mimic the physiological conditions found in the human body and ensure that cells remain healthy and viable during experimentation. cell culture companies offer a wide range of media formulations to support different cell types and research applications, allowing researchers to optimize their experimental conditions and achieve reliable and reproducible results.
Furthermore, cell culture companies provide researchers with a range of specialized equipment and technologies that facilitate the cultivation and analysis of cells in a laboratory setting. These include cell culture incubators, bioreactors, automated cell culture systems, and high-throughput screening platforms that enable researchers to perform experiments efficiently and effectively.
